Omega Tank Watch Description

The real historical watch from the world famous brand Omega.

Square in shape, a bit like Cartier, the watch is very comfortable on the wrist and has a vintage look. The watch case is made of durable stainless steel.

The dial of the watch was professionally restored.

Omega Watch Characteritics

  • Year: 1940's
  • Movement: Mechanical
  • Case materials: Stainless Steel
  • Strap materials: Stainless Steel
  • Made in Switzerland.
